Output 64955f4ce1e350ada84343acd277c6c037065573f7e9ddcb819807630db3ce8d:86

value
1201487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76960f3d4080f0be70712e5c33e11785822488bf OP_EQUAL
address
3CW3RVsQsF8CnHbZDupJfJDTphzsTNbJwJ
transaction
64955f4ce1e350ada84343acd277c6c037065573f7e9ddcb819807630db3ce8d
confirmations
232662
spent
true